TRM Labs

TRM Labs is a leading on-chain risk and illicit activity prevention platform trusted by financial institutions, digital asset platforms, and government agencies worldwide. Its advanced on-chain transaction monitoring engine evaluates transactions across multiple chains.
Main Features:
- Advanced on-chain transaction monitoring
- Illicit fund prevention across all major chains
- Live AML screening
- API-first integration for financial institutions
Token Terminal

For evaluating the real fundamental health of blockchain projects, Token Terminal is the research standard. By aggregating revenue, fees, user growth, and total value locked metrics across hundreds of blockchain projects.
Main Features:
- Earnings and income analysis across hundreds of protocols
- Total Value Locked and user metrics tracking
- Comparative fundamental analysis
- Long-term project health intelligence
Nansen

Nansen excels in smart money tracking and on-chain data granularity. Its extensive wallet labeling system appeals to crypto researchers looking for a competitive research edge.
Key Features:
- Extensive smart money labeling database
- Real-time on-chain wallet transaction monitoring
- Token movement analysis across Ethereum
- Customizable research dashboards
DeFiLlama

DeFiLlama is the leading free DeFi total value locked and ecosystem tracker in the crypto industry. Covering hundreds of DeFi protocols across all major blockchains, DeFiLlama delivers live TVL, yield intelligence, and protocol health data — all entirely at no cost.
Main Features:
- Live total value locked tracking across thousands of protocols
- Yield comparison across all major chains
- Ecosystem status and fee metrics
- Completely open-source with no subscription required

Dune Analytics

Dune Analytics is the leading open-source blockchain analytics platform for analysts who need custom code-driven dashboards. Its massive community of analysts has built tens of thousands of public dashboards covering virtually all blockchain project imaginable.
Key Features:
- Code-driven bespoke dashboard creation
- Massive community-built analytics repository
- Live blockchain data from all major blockchains
- Open-source tier for individual researchers
Chainalysis

As the world's leading blockchain compliance platform, Chainalysis sets the benchmark for anti-money laundering and compliance tooling. Trusted by governments, financial institutions, and digital asset platforms worldwide, it delivers institutional-grade compliance and transaction forensics tools.
Key Features:
- Institutional-grade anti-money laundering and compliance assessment
- Real-time blockchain fund flow monitoring
- Criminal activity investigation across all major chains
- Government and regulatory quality tools
Glassnode

Glassnode is the undisputed leader in macro blockchain market metrics. Its library of proprietary on-chain indicators gives professional market analysts an unparalleled view of market cycle dynamics.
Key Features:
- Thousands of proprietary on-chain indicators
- Deep Bitcoin and Ethereum market cycle intelligence
- Professional futures market data
- Customizable data alerts and export capabilities
